Bio by DG Bender;
Johannes SCHAFER born 24 March 1854 in Johannestal, Beresan, Odessa, South Russia was the son of Heinrich SCHAEFER and Magdalena EISSINGER.
Johannes at the age of 19 with his parents and siblings; Adam, Maria, Karl, Magdalena and Susanna, immigrated to America via the Port of Hamburg, Germany aboard the SS "Westphalia" and arrived at the Port of New York, New York on the 23rd of July 1873.
Johannes married Fredericka SAYLER on the 15th of November 1877 in Lesterville, Yankton County, Dakota Territory. This union was blessed with 18 children.

From JOHANNES SAYLER BOOK Pg# 38 by Verine (Sayler) REIMANN:
In 1873 Johannes SCHAFER immigrated to the US making his first home in Lesterville, South Dakota. After his marriage to Friedricka SAYLER they moved to a farm near Lesterville, where they lived with their family until 1902 when they traveled to North Dakota with 13 children and settled about 8 miles southwest of Underwood, North Dakota. Mr. SCHAFER purchased the Charles MERRILL farm in Township 145-83. They retired in 1920 and moved into Underwood. Mr. SCHAFER's death was caused by a hemorrhage. Friedericka came to this country when a girl of 14. Her parents lived a year at Sandusky, Ohio before moving to Lesteville, SD in 1874. After her husband's death, she remained in Underwood one year then made her home with her daughter, Mrs. Don SCHULZ and Mrs. Henry AUCH of Washburn, North Dakota.
